Ghana’s NIA calls for policy to synchronize ID cards

Published: 17/Avr/2015
Source: SPY Ghana

The National Identification Authority (NIA) is calling for a policy to synchronize identity cards in the country into one.

Head, Administration/Legal & Compliance of the NIA, Josef Iroko told SpyGhana.com in an interview over the weekend the situation where people carry different identity cards was not the best according to international standards.

“We need a policy decision to avoid multiple identity cards so that one card will serve as your voter ID, Social Security and National Insurance Trust (SSNIT) card, National Health Insurance Scheme (NHIS), driving license etc,” he said.

Iroko emphasized the phenomenon of multiplicity of identity cards in the country could be attributed to the fact that most of the institutions existed before the NIA was established.
